Mono Pumps

Mono pumps, also known as spiral pumps, auger pumps or mud pumps; It is the type of pump used in the transfer of particulate liquids, high viscosity fluids. It is frequently used in biogas, treatment and food sectors.

What Is A Mono Pumps?

Mono pumps, also known as spiral pumps, auger pumps or mud pumps; With the help of power transferred from the electric motor, the fluid of a metal auger moving in the logic of infinite screws is based on the transfer of the fluid. In the meantime, special auxiliary elements (shaft, coupling rod, rotor, stator…etc) are used for mono pumps. Shaft drive in mono pumps, as in many positive displacement pumps; It is made from the gearbox output. Each mono pump model; Minimum and maximum operating speeds are determined in the performance tables of the pumps. Optimum efficiency is tried to be obtained by choosing the most suitable engine power and gearbox speed for the capacity-pressure values required by the user. While making these choices, the viscosity, abrasiveness and process pressure of the fluid are decisive.

What Are The Advantages of Mono Pumps?

One of the first pump types that comes to mind when it comes to difficult fluid transfer is mono pumps. Mono pumps are preferred because they offer good solutions in the transfer of fluids containing viscose, abrasive, sticky, solid particles, etc. We can say that users are very familiar with mono pumps, as there is a need for the transfer of such fluids in many industrial applications. Mono pumps with AIS and casting body options; When rotor and stator materials are selected appropriately, they can be used in many different processes and fluid transfers. They can be driven between maximum and minimum working speeds by using auxiliary equipment; It is very important in terms of responding to the different pressure and capacity needs that occur in the process. At different stages of the process, using frequency inverters; If the capacity of the transferred fluid is desired to be changed, mono pumps will be quite good choices.

The gaps between the mono pump rotor and stator folds are designed to allow for solid particulate fluid transfer. These features; It also provides the opportunity to transfer mono pumps to surface sensitive products without damaging them. Mono pump sealing is achieved using a mechanical or soft seal. The criterion for this selection is again the characteristic of the transferred fluid. Soft seals can be used according to the fluid feature, or special mechanical seals can be selected.

Fluid transfer can be made without impact and stably. There are various installation alternatives and design options. With its wide suction mouth, even viscous fluids can be easily absorbed into the pump. The electric motor can change the direction of the two-way operation. (Using the suction direction as a compression direction) Alternative models with bearing bearings and couplings are available.
